Q: Is 380,202,220 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 380,202,220 is a composite number.

Why is 380,202,220 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 380,202,220 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 10 20 67 134 167 268 334 335 668 670 835 1,340 1,670 1,699 3,340 3,398 6,796 8,495 11,189 16,990 22,378 33,980 44,756 55,945 111,890 113,833 223,780 227,666 283,733 455,332 567,466 569,165 1,134,932 1,138,330 1,418,665 2,276,660 2,837,330 5,674,660 19,010,111 38,020,222 76,040,444 95,050,555 190,101,110 and 380,202,220, with no remainder.

Since 380,202,220 cannot be divided by just 1 and 380,202,220, it is a composite number.
